原文:常見的linux上的服務重啟腳本

手寫linux上的重啟腳本,先把提綱列下 .檢查進程是否存在 存在殺死 .備份原來的包到指定目錄 . 拉取新包,我這邊為了簡便,沒有從jenkins slave上拿 .啟動命令 .檢查是否進程起來了 bin bash path JAVA usr java jdk . . amd bin java APP HOME opt bugs APPNAME TestPlatform.jar APP PARA ...

2019-07-16 10:28 0 1554 推薦指數:

查看詳情

linux腳本重啟java服務

!/bin/bashpid=$(ps -ef | grep zwdatatransfer-1.0.0.jar | grep -v 'grep' | awk '{print $2}')kill -9 $ ...

Tue Dec 07 05:00:00 CST 2021 0 866
linux shell java服務啟動重啟腳本

服務啟動腳本 平時自己項目修改后重新部署太麻煩了,就自己寫了一個shell腳本 腳本可以重啟或重新部署項目,並保存舊jar包 僅作為記錄用,並不適合直接使用,可以拿去抄作業修改下在自己服務器用 PS:如果發現運行shell腳本有權限問題 使用 ...

Thu Sep 03 17:41:00 CST 2020 0 1138
Linux重啟多個 tomcat 服務腳本

由於修改tomcat的配置文件或手動操作數據庫數據后,tomcat的緩存和redis的緩存很嚴重,需要經常重啟tomcat來釋放緩存,經常就是手動重啟。 剛接觸這些命令的時候,會經常的手動去敲命令然后練習加深,久而久之,感覺是在浪費時間(有時候會頻繁修改數據庫內容)。 所以就想 ...

Wed Jun 28 23:58:00 CST 2017 0 2933
linux重啟服務腳本命令

最近做網站測試,每次測試完成都要重啟服務,為此寫了一個簡單的shell腳本 ...

Thu Jan 19 18:15:00 CST 2017 0 14458
linux服務器掛掉自動重啟腳本(轉)

實現原理主要是使用linux提供的crontab機制,定時查詢服務器進程是否存在,如果宕機則執行我們預設的重啟腳本。 首先我們要向crontab加入一個新任務 我這里只是簡單的設置每分鍾調用一個shell腳本monitor.sh。這里可以配置的更強大,大家可以去搜索一下 ...

Fri Apr 19 23:46:00 CST 2019 0 1307
linux服務器重啟tomcat並且清除work緩存的腳本

因為每次工程部署到linux中后,都要重啟tomcat+清除work緩存,每次操作命令都要重復的打好多,kill、start等等 而且在技術經理的建議下買了一本shell編程的書,自學了下整理了一份重啟tomcat和自動清除此tomcat下緩存的sh腳本,供大家使用,還是比較方便的,現在測試部門 ...

Thu Apr 07 23:28:00 CST 2016 0 1879
linux環境中Java服務通過shell腳本重啟(升級)自己

今天遇到一個遠程升級的需求,通過接口去觸發終端服務的接口,重新拉取最新的jar包,並重啟終端服務,這個終端服務是用java寫的。 實現該需求,兩個步驟,一個是需要一個shell腳本:拉取jar包、kill掉服務、啟動服務;還有一個就是java中收到消息去調用shell腳本腳本 啟動 ...

Sat Apr 10 00:45:00 CST 2021 0 423
Linux下自動監測並重啟Apache服務腳本

為了達到一個高可用的基於Apache的網站環境,在Apache由於種種原因自動停止運行之后,想立即恢復網站訪問,這就需要有個工具實時監測Apache的運行狀態並能夠自動重啟httpd服務,寫了一個簡單的監測和重啟腳本: 原理:通過服務器本地訪問自身Apache服務(與用戶訪問網站類似),如超過 ...

Fri Sep 29 00:47:00 CST 2017 0 1090
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M